Can engineers be hourly employees?

Yes, engineers can be hourly employees, especially in roles involving project-based work, consulting, or contract positions. However, many engineering roles are salaried, particularly in full-time positions with benefits, and may require specific certifications or skills. Employment type often depends on the employer and the nature of the work performed.

What do engineers in hour get paid an hour?

Engineers typically earn between $25 and $100 per hour, depending on their experience, specialization, location, and industry. Entry-level engineers may start at lower rates, while experienced professionals or those with specialized skills can command higher wages. Freelance or contract engineers often set their own hourly rates based on project scope and expertise.

Auria is a leading global supplier of highly-engineered systems for automotive flooring, acoustical, thermal, aerodynamic and other fiber-based solutions for gas and electric vehicles. With U.S.-based operational headquarters in Southfield, Michigan, Auria operates 16 manufacturing, 9 technical and 5 JV locations across 10 countries and employs approximately 3,900 people worldwide.
We are currently searching for Robot Programmer to join our team at our Spartanburg Plant in Spartanburg, SC.
What you will do:
  • Load robot programs and configure I/O
  • Ability to write, test and modify programs.
  • Ability to troubleshoot, diagnose, and modify current programs. (ABB, Fanuc,YASKAWA)
  • Strong ability to troubleshoot equipment issues and perform subsequent repairs necessary to return the equipment back to operational status.
  • Ability to perform calibrations and troubleshoot mechanical issues. Such as changing components (wiring, motors, boards, drives).
  • Reassemble, adjust, and test repaired equipment to ensure a quality part is being produced.
  • Ability to communicate and coordinate repairs with off-site OEM Phone Support.
  • Perform preventive maintenance tasks as required by the plant preventive maintenance program. Entering preventive maintenance data into the plant P.M. system software.
  • Perform the duties of a robotics programmer in a safe, responsible manner, obeying all plant safety rules while on the job.
  • Practice good housekeeping in all areas.
  • Other duties and responsibilities as required by the supervisor to maintain and operate a safe, efficient, and quality conscious operation.

What you will bring:
  • Associates Degree (AA) or equivalent from two-year college or technical school
  • Preferred 2-3 years plant maintenance experience in a manufacturing environment, utilizing basic PLC, Robotic Programming (ABB, Fanuc, Motoman)
  • Experience with PLC's is desirable (Allen Bradley and/or Siemens)
  • Must have skills in reading electrical and mechanical prints
  • Must be available to work 12 hour shift
  • Must be available to work off shift
  • Must be available to work overtime and holidays

Travel Requirements: As needed for training or support of other facilities
